Antonio Seguí's market splits by medium. Prints & Editions (5 lots) median $229 with 60% sell-through. Paintings (30 lots) median $40,000, record $125,000. A typical Antonio Seguí painting sells for around 175× the price of a typical print. At the top of the market (top 5% of sales, 6 lots) the median is $96,250.
